show global-mac-table
This command displays the pool of (eight) MAC addresses with their prefixes (automatically generated or manually configured) and shows if they are being used by an underlying interface.
Syntax
show global-mac-table
Command Mode
Basic and Privileged User
Related Commands
■ | To configure the prefix of the MAC addresses in the pool: set admin-global-mac |
■ | To enable and associate a MAC address from the pool with an underlying interface: (conf-if-<interface>)# mac auto |
Example
# show global-mac-table
Global Mac Table:
[ 0]: status: occupied mac:02:90:8f
[ 1]: status: free mac:02:91:8f
[ 2]: status: free mac:02:92:8f
[ 3]: status: free mac:02:93:8f
[ 4]: status: free mac:02:94:8f
[ 5]: status: free mac:02:95:8f
[ 6]: status: free mac:02:96:8f
[ 7]: status: free mac:02:97:8f
